OFFICE OF FAITH FORMATION RCIA—RITE OF CHRISTIAN INITATION OF ADULTS
This is a process, which provides preparation for adults who seek full initiation into the Catholic Church through the reception of the Sacraments of Baptism, Confirmation, and Eucharist. This process is also adapted for older children who seek full initiation into the Church and is sometimes referred to as The Rite of Christian Initiation of Children (RCIC). The RCIA process also provides for: A) The preparation of baptized Catholics who wish to complete their initiation into the Church through the reception of the Sacraments of Confirmation and Eucharist. B) The preparation of validly baptized Christians from other traditions, who wish to be brought into Full Communion in the Catholic Church. The Defensive Driving Course is a 6-hour classroom course pre-sented by the National Safety Council which offers you a new ap-proach to learning accident prevention skills. When you complete the course you become eligible for motor vehicle insurance discounts, each year, for a full 3 years!
